Ya I;m in for more LSJ building!

This tune is so custom and far off right now that it will be done in 3 steps with each getting harder.

1st tuning the idle pretty easy since you're only working with max 750rpm range

2nd DD table harder but still easy set the A/F to 14.7 and go from there

3rd WOT tuning everyone here knows how much time that takes we're into 10 logs for marks car right now and it isn't a 100% custom job!

So I'm hoping to get set 1 and 2 done on sat and start into 3 but I think that will take a couple weeks or so to get fully worked out but for a DD it will be 100% better to drive and better on gas too! I'm surprised it doesn't surge and bog everywhere with it's current tune!
